Quote: Originally Posted by justintime
If we create a patch for 2.1.2NA, I don't think it can be applied to 2.1 or 2.1.1. Or can it?!

I can't see how we are going to get around having to modify each version manually prior to generating a patch.

Alright, this is just a bunch of brainstorming and is all over the place, so stick with me

It can. They would just be running a 2.1.2 exe with the 2.1 data files (which works fine.) The only question I have is if this is ethical. I mean they would need to buy iguidance to use the program anyway, right?

Let me clarify: I just feed my bdiff program an input file and an output file and it makes a third file to show what the differences between the two are. So if i fed it iguidance 2.1 as the input and JIT's 2.1.2 as output then anyone could use the patch to turn their 2.1 exe into a 2.1.2 exe (but only if they had 2.1).

However the point of the diff files was they would only contain changes that us the community made and no iguidance code. The 2.1 to 2.1.2 diff would contain the code for 2.1.2 that 2.1 lacks.

So you see... I'm not sure if its a good idea. Downgrading is fine, but free public upgrades is probably shunned upon.

JIT you should message me on how you are making these changes so I can make a 2.1 exe with all the changes you have. Is there any way to export all the resources for a program and input them into another program?

If you build a patcher to take 2.1 to a 2.1.2NA, then the patcher will contain code from v 2.1.2NA. This is really not very different from distributin v 2.1.2NA, so really should not be done. It is OK to distribute a patcher than will ONLY contain new images etc, but if it contains original iGuidance code then I can see how they would balk at the idea.

Maybe there is a way to export the new resources (icons, windows, etc) and import them into 2.1 to create a patch. Will find out.
